Latest price of Azerbaijani oil
Energy
- 03 September, 2025
- 09:50
The price of Azerbaijan's Azeri LT CIF oil in the world market increased by $0.71, or 1%, to $71.25 per barrel, Report informs.
October futures for Brent crude were traded at $69.43 per barrel.
The price of a barrel of Azerbaijani oil of the Azeri LT CIF on Free on Board (FOB) basis at Türkiye's Ceyhan port rose by $0.70 or 1.01%, amounting to $69.76.
The average oil price in Azerbaijan's state budget for 2025 was set at $70 per barrel.
The lowest price for Azeri Light was recorded on April 21, 2020 ($15.81), and the all-time high of $149.66 was fixed in July 2008.
